Market Context

Carrier (CARR) traded recently at $63.84, down about 1.28% from the prior session, with the stock oscillating between well-established support near $60.65 and resistance just above $67.03. Volume patterns have remained relatively subdued in the past few weeks, suggesting the pullback may be more of a consolidation phase than a broad shift in sentiment. The home-construction and commercial-real-estate sectors have shown mixed signals, which could weigh on Carrier’s near-term momentum given its exposure to HVAC and building solutions. Meanwhile, broader industrial indices have been choppy, with investors parsing new data on materials costs and labor availability. Industry-specific drivers—such as ongoing shifts toward energy-efficient systems and potential regulatory updates in the commercial-refrigeration space—may be contributing to selective buying interest, though no single catalyst has emerged to break the stock from its current range. The slight decline today aligns with modest profit-taking seen across several industrial names, and the stock continues to trade within its recent band, indicating that market participants are weighing macroeconomic caution against Carrier’s steady positioning in nonresidential and replacement markets. Technical Analysis

Carrier’s shares have been trading in a defined range since the start of the year, with the current price of $63.84 settling roughly midway between established support near $60.65 and resistance at $67.03. Over the past several weeks, the stock has tested the lower boundary twice and bounced higher each time, suggesting that buyers are stepping in near that level. However, each rally has stalled well before reaching resistance, indicating that upside momentum remains limited. From a trend perspective, the stock is attempting to form a higher low above the $60.65 support, which could set the stage for a potential breakout if volume picks up. Meanwhile, momentum oscillators are in neutral territory—neither oversold nor overbought—leaving room for movement in either direction. The relative strength index sits in the mid-range, reflecting the indecisive price action. A sustained move above the $63 area would be a constructive first step, but a clear push through $67.03 would be needed to confirm a bullish shift. Conversely, a breakdown below $60.65 could open the door to a retest of the next lower support zone. Traders may watch for volume confirmation on any directional move, as recent trading has been characterized by below-average activity. Outlook

Carrier's outlook hinges on its ability to sustain momentum amid a shifting macroeconomic landscape. The stock currently trades between established support at $60.65 and resistance near $67.03, reflecting a relatively orderly consolidation phase. A sustained move above the resistance level could signal renewed buying interest, potentially driven by seasonal HVAC demand or favorable policy developments around energy efficiency standards. Conversely, a breakdown below support might invite further downside, especially if interest rates remain elevated or if supply chain disruptions reemerge. Key influencing factors include the pace of residential and commercial construction activity, regulatory shifts regarding refrigerants, and Carrier’s execution on its operational efficiency initiatives. No recent earnings data is available to guide near-term expectations, so market participants are likely watching industry trends and broader economic indicators. The company’s exposure to both new-build and retrofit markets provides some diversification, but sensitivity to consumer spending and corporate capex cycles introduces uncertainty. Traders may watch for volume confirmation around the noted levels; high volume on a breakout or breakdown would lend more conviction to the move. In the coming weeks, the stock's direction could be shaped by macroeconomic data releases and any forward-looking commentary from the sector.
